How to Choose the Right Data Mining Service Provider for Your Business


Data mining illustration showing business teams analyzing data, insights, and performance dashboards for growth

In today’s hyper-connected and data-saturated world, businesses that effectively harness their information assets gain a significant competitive edge. Data mining, the process of discovering patterns and insights from large datasets, is no longer a niche technology but a fundamental driver of strategic decision-making, enhanced Customer Experience, and improved Business Outcomes. However, extracting meaningful value from raw data is a complex undertaking, often requiring specialized expertise and advanced technological capabilities. This is where the strategic partnership with a data mining service provider becomes invaluable.

Navigating the landscape of available providers can be daunting. The global data mining tools market, valued at USD 1.27 billion in 2025, is projected to reach USD 3.49 billion by 2034, demonstrating a substantial and growing demand for these services [Fortune Business Insights, 2025]. With the increasing integration of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ning into business operations, selecting the right partner is crucial for unlocking AI-driven insights, optimizing Marketing Campaigns, improving Sales Effectiveness, and achieving ambitious goals like fraud detection or predictive banking. This comprehensive guide will walk you through the essential considerations for choosing a data mining service provider that aligns with your business needs and propels you toward success.

Understand Your Data Needs

Before embarking on the search for a data mining service provider, a critical first step is to conduct a thorough internal assessment of your business’s unique objectives and the specific data needs that underpin them. Without this clarity, you risk engaging a partner whose services don’t genuinely address your core challenges or capitalize on your most significant opportunities.

Begin by precisely defining what you aim to achieve. Are you looking to enhance the effectiveness of your customer loyalty programs, improve overall Customer Experience, or boost Customer Engagement? Perhaps your primary focus lies in conducting in-depth market research to uncover new growth avenues or implementing robust fraud detection mechanisms to mitigate financial risks. Identifying specific business strategies that require data support is paramount. For instance, understanding customer behavior analysis can lead to more targeted Marketing Campaigns and improved Customer Relationship Management. Consider the potential impact on areas like Product Experience and Brand Experience.

Furthermore, assess your existing Data Assets. What types of data do you possess (e.g., transactional data, behavioral data, social media data)? What are the potential Data Silos that might hinder a unified view? Understanding the journey from raw data to actionable insights also necessitates an appreciation for data preparation and Data Quality. A provider’s ability to address issues related to Data Quality management and perform meticulous data preparation will be key to generating reliable AI-driven insights. This foundational understanding ensures that you can articulate your needs clearly and evaluate potential providers based on their capacity to deliver tangible Business Outcomes.

Check Expertise and Experience

When considering a partner for something as pivotal as data mining, their expertise and experience are not merely desirable traits but absolute necessities. The right data mining service provider will possess a profound understanding of various Data Analytics techniques, Machine Learning, Artificial Intelligence, and crucially, how to apply them to achieve measurable Business Outcomes.

It is essential to look for providers with a proven track record within your specific industry. For example, the financial services sector leads with a significant adoption rate of advanced analytics, with some reports indicating over 90% of organizations achieving measurable value from data and analytics investments in 2023 [Coherent Solutions, 2025]. This highlights that providers with strong financial sector experience can offer substantial advantages in areas like predictive banking or risk mitigation. Similarly, if your business operates in healthcare, providers with a background in Healthcare analytics will be far better equipped to comprehend your unique challenges, data sensitivities, and regulatory landscapes.

Beyond industry-specific knowledge, evaluate their experience with particular Data Mining Tools and methodologies. Do they have a portfolio of successful projects that demonstrate their ability to handle complex data analysis and deliver insightful business intelligence? Inquire about their approach to predictive analytics and predictive modeling. A provider’s ability to navigate the complexities of Natural Language Processing for unstructured text data or implement effective fraud detection algorithms should be a key consideration. Ultimately, the provider’s depth of knowledge and their demonstrated success in similar contexts will be a strong indicator of their potential to deliver exceptional value.

Evaluate Their Technology

The technological prowess of a data mining service provider is a critical determinant of the quality, efficiency, and scalability of the insights they can deliver. A top-tier provider will utilize a robust suite of Data Mining Tools, including advanced analytics engines and platforms capable of handling vast datasets with both speed and accuracy. It is crucial to inquire about their Tech Stack. Are they leveraging cloud computing, and if so, which cloud service provider do they partner with? Understanding their approach to data management and organization, including their use of ETL (extract, transform, load) processes or more advanced Data Pipelines, is vital for seamless data integration and efficient Data Processing.

Furthermore, assess how their technological capabilities align with your existing data systems and IT modernization initiatives. Providers adept at integrating with cloud-based solutions, on-premises data warehouse environments, or emerging Data Lakehouse architecture will offer greater flexibility. Do they employ modern technologies like Apache Spark or Apache Kafka for real-time data ingestion and processing, enabling Real-time Event Streaming? Their ability to manage schema drift through practices like schema alignment and implement field-level tagging is also a strong indicator of their commitment to data integrity and future-proofing. Consider their use of SaaS Tools and their capacity for automated ingestion of data from various sources, such as Google Analytics or other web analytics platforms.

A provider’s technological sophistication directly impacts their capacity to transform raw data into actionable AI-driven insights.

Prioritize Data Security and Compliance

When engaging a data mining service provider, particularly when entrusting them with sensitive business information, data security and compliance are not merely important considerations—they are non-negotiable prerequisites. You are essentially entrusting your most valuable information assets to a third party, making robust security measures and unwavering adherence to regulatory frameworks essential.

Thoroughly investigate the provider’s security protocols. This includes examining their data encryption practices, both for data at rest and in transit, their stringent access control policies, and their overall cybersecurity posture. They should possess well-defined data protection policies and demonstrate a proactive approach to risk mitigation. Understanding their approach to immutable logs and ensuring audit-ready systems is crucial for transparency and accountability. Furthermore, delve into their capabilities for Data Encryption and their commitment to regulatory compliance. This is particularly vital given the increasing global pressure surrounding data privacy regulations. They must be knowledgeable about and compliant with international and local data protection laws relevant to your industry.

A provider that can demonstrate adherence to standards like GDPR or CCPA and can offer assurances regarding Data Lineage and the secure handling of data is a testament to their trustworthiness and operational integrity. Failing to prioritize these aspects could lead to severe repercussions, including breaches, fines, and reputational damage.

Compare Pricing and Value

When evaluating data mining service providers, pricing is undoubtedly a significant consideration, but it should never be the sole deciding factor. The true measure of a provider’s offering lies in the value they deliver. A provider with a slightly higher cost might offer superior accuracy, faster turnaround times, more robust security measures, or more advanced analytical capabilities, ultimately leading to a greater return on investment (ROI). It’s crucial to look beyond the sticker price and understand the comprehensive value proposition.

Request detailed pricing breakdowns for all services offered. Be vigilant about potential hidden fees, such as those related to Data Extraction, additional data analysis, or specific data visualization requirements. Providers should be transparent about their pricing models, whether they are project-based, subscription-based (common for SaaS Tools), or retainer-based. Understand what is included in the standard service and what constitutes an additional cost. Furthermore, assess how the provider demonstrates ROI. Do they offer clear metrics and reporting that tie their services directly to your defined Business Outcomes? Comparing not just the cost, but the potential return and the overall value delivered, will lead to a more strategic and financially sound decision. For example, a provider offering advanced fraud detection capabilities might have a higher upfront cost but could save your business significantly more through risk mitigation.

Test Communication and Support

Effective communication and reliable support are the bedrock of any successful partnership, especially when dealing with complex data mining projects. Choose a provider that demonstrates clear, consistent, and prompt communication. During the evaluation phase, observe how quickly they respond to your inquiries and the clarity of their explanations. This initial interaction can be a strong indicator of their ongoing client support.

A good data mining service provider will keep you informed about the progress of your project, provide regular updates on their findings, and be readily available to address any questions or concerns that may arise. This includes their approach to client support and the specific Service Level Agreements (SLAs) they offer. SLAs should clearly define response times for critical issues, escalation procedures, and availability of support channels. Consider their availability across different time zones if your business operates globally. Understanding their commitment to providing ongoing support, including training and documentation, is crucial for ensuring the long-term success and adoption of their insights within your organization. A provider that fosters open dialogue and provides consistent support minimizes the risk of misunderstandings and ensures that the insights derived from your raw data are effectively integrated into your operations.
